Where is Ebola virus found regionally?

Explanation:
The Ebola virus is found regionally in Africa. Historically, outbreaks have occurred in Central and West African countries, with the largest recent outbreak affecting Guinea, Sierra Leone, and Liberia. The virus is linked to fruit bat reservoirs in Africa, and while there have been isolated imported cases elsewhere, there is no sustained endemic transmission outside Africa.
